Tourism Policy -2016
• As per Tourism Policy – 2016 under Incentive scheme
Tourism is boosting in Maharshtra.
• The projects useful for developing tourism are
registered under Incentive Scheme.
• Registered projects get discount in excise Duty, light
bill, extended FSI etc.
• In Nashik Hotel Express Inn, Grand Rio, hotel Yahoo
got benefits under Incentive Scheme.
Agro Tourism
• Agritourism or agrotourism, as it is defined most broadly, involves
any agriculturalry based operation or activity that brings visitors to
a Farmar.
• Agritourism has different definitions in different parts of the world, and
sometimes refers specifically to farm Stays.
• Agritourism includes a wide variety of activities, including buying produce
direct from a farm stand, navigating a Corn maze, slopping hogs, picking
fruit, feeding animals, or staying at a bed and breakfast (B&B) on a farm.
• In Nashik Many Farmers involved in agro tourism .
• Sahyadri farm is the leading example of agro Tourism in Nashik. This is a
group of farmers that grow fruits & vegetables on less than 1 Hectare of
land. This is Indias Leading Farmers Producer Copmany.
CAREER IN TOURISM AND HOSPITALITY
1) TRAVEL AGENT - Travel Agents research, plan, and book trips for
individuals and groups. Although people are starting to research and book
their travel plans online, it’s often easier to use a Travel Agent, as they have
years of experience and knowledge. They are able to help with flight
bookings, hotel selection, transfer arrangements, and holiday activities.
A Travel Agent need great organisational skills, attention to detail, and the
ability to think on your feet. Find out more about a day in the life of a
Travel Consultant.
2) HOTEL MANAGER - Hotel Managers oversee all aspects of running a
hotel – from housekeeping and general maintenance to budget management
and marketing of the hotel. A Hotel Manager need excellent interpersonal
skills, experience in the hospitality industry, and a number of years’
experience in managing employees.
3) SPA MANAGER - Spa Managers are responsible for the day-to-day
running of health and/or beauty spas. They manage a spa’s finances,
employees, and services. Many of the tasks are business-related and can
include recordkeeping, getting involved in promotional campaigns,
maintaining stock inventories, and payroll management.
4) TOUR OPERATOR - A Tour Operator typically combines tour and travel
components to create holiday packages. He or she will deal with various
service providers, including bus operators, airlines and hoteliers.
• Tour Operators prepare itineraries for various destinations and will often
monitor trends in popular destinations in order to put together attractive
holiday packages for clients. Tour Operators mainly deal with Travel
Agents, while Travel Agents deal with the public.
